Density Altitude at Pensacola International (KPNS)
Pensacola International sits at 121 ft, and even a typical July afternoon (92 °F) only lifts density altitude to about 2,233 ft — heat still trims performance, but the field rarely turns high-and-hot.
Typical density altitude by month
| Month | Avg temp °F | DA at avg temp | Afternoon high °F | DA on a typical afternoon |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| 53.2 | −217 ft | 62.7 | 410 ft |
| February | 56.8 | 22 ft | 66.4 | 650 ft |
| March | 62.3 | 384 ft | 72.0 | 1,010 ft |
| April | 68.3 | 773 ft | 77.6 | 1,365 ft |
| May | 76.0 | 1,264 ft | 85.1 | 1,833 ft |
| June | 81.7 | 1,622 ft | 90.0 | 2,135 ft |
| July | 83.5 | 1,734 ft | 91.6 | 2,233 ft |
| August | 83.0 | 1,703 ft | 91.0 | 2,196 ft |
| September | 80.0 | 1,516 ft | 88.5 | 2,043 ft |
| October | 71.3 | 965 ft | 81.1 | 1,584 ft |
| November | 61.4 | 325 ft | 71.8 | 997 ft |
| December | 55.5 | −64 ft | 65.1 | 566 ft |
▲ above 5,000 ft · ⚠ above 8,000 ft. These are planning references at standard pressure and dry air — afternoon humidity and low pressure both push the real number higher. Run today's values below.

Frequently asked questions
How high does density altitude get at KPNS in summer?
On a typical July afternoon — around 92 °F at the nearest NOAA normals station — density altitude at Pensacola International reaches roughly 2,233 ft at standard pressure. Hotter-than-normal days, low pressure, and humidity all push it higher, so run the day's actual numbers before flying.
What is the density altitude at KPNS on an average day?
It swings with the seasons: from roughly −217 ft at the coldest month's average temperature to about 1,734 ft at the warmest month's — all from a constant field elevation of 121 ft. The month-by-month table above carries the full year.
What is the field elevation of Pensacola International?
121 ft MSL, from the FAA NASR airport record (28-day cycle effective 2026-08-06). The identifier is KPNS (ICAO) / PNS (FAA), in Pensacola, Florida.
